php之推薦vim
最近幾天寫著公司的一個專案,修修改改,有些地方還記得有些地方記不住了,就必須重新演示一下程式的流程,然後除錯,列印,才能想到當時的程式思路。不免有點憂傷,
就想到底怎麼了?
是誰的問題?是滑鼠的問題,因為我們在編寫過程中移動,查詢還是對比刪除的操作遠遠多於碼字,所以再移動手指去趙樹彪,你的瞬間記憶也許就被打斷了,長期意外也許你就真的無法長久記住你的程式思路,需要完整的復原,甚至列印出無關緊要的點來實現程式的再現。
所以我想到了編輯器之神vim,一直不感冒這個,因為這個一直被崇尚簡潔的蘋果所獨寵的感覺,後來一直在用notepad,也沒感覺到它的神奇之處,竟然覺得還不如subtext的友好。
這裡提一下我喜歡的一本書<mactalk人生超程式設計>,我現在沒用mac,之前朋友和我為了寫蘋果app,入手可一個專業版的apple pro。這裡還是要稱讚一下堪比京東的送貨速度的深圳友商,感覺你不管在那個犄角旮旯,都可以迅速送到。這和內地很多地方的區別是很大,也許說好的當天到,快遞員畢竟是人,雖然收到了,不一定立馬送出來
回到正題,還是老老實實用windows,感覺舒服,等到了必須要去linux下程式設計時再說。現在寫個php哈真的是window舒服
好的現在真的迴歸正題。也許你覺得我真的是說了很多廢話,不過大家也許真的有這個心路歷程,就能夠知道我為何寫這篇文章了,我終於想學習vim了,英文還可以,之前還想著翻譯ORACLE DBA 兩天教程,翻譯完目錄,我就覺得沒有啥感興趣的了,再加上也沒有任何人有需求,我就不打算翻譯了,至少目前是
vim裡面有個人性的vimtutor,號稱30分鐘教程。
我覺得還是挺好玩的,很好學,很有意思。因為這個教程不是一本死書,而是一個有趣的互動訓練
程式碼如下
1
2
3
4
5
6
7
8
9
10
11
12
13
|
lesson 2.5:using a count to delete more
***typing a number with an operation repeates it that many times.**
in the combination of the delete operator and a motion mentioned above you insert
a count before the motion to delete more:
d number motion
1.move the cursor to the first UPPER CASE word in the line marked--->
2.Type d2w to delete the two UPPER CASE words.
3.Repeat steps 1 and 2 with a different count to delete the consecutive
UUPER CASE words with one command
---> this ABC DE line FGHI JK LMN OP of words is Q RS TUV cleaned up.
終於打完了,我開心的心情讓我自己手動打了一小段
|
vim號稱是面向程式設計師的編輯器,不是程式設計師不會用到。
第一行:標題–》利用計數去刪除更多
第二行:註釋—》輸入一個數字,讓操作符重複很多次
第三行到第五航,是對的命令的解釋,怎麼使用 就是d + 數字 + 模式(w,e,$)
第六行到第十行是一個步驟
第十一行就是感興趣的地方,就是讓你移動滑鼠到這裡,然後輸入命令就可以感受到操作結果,寓教於樂,怎能不學得快
這是一種生活理念。今天我寫vim不是為了要求去學習vim。我只是想說曾經我們的長輩因為教育資源的匱乏,認為世界的資源是很有限的,我們每個人只要照顧好自己就好,世界和自己沒有關係,詩和遠方不是新中國的初級階段考慮的,我覺得沒有錯,他們的思想對於那個時代是對的,因為我們還很弱小,需要解決溫飽,當我們生活在和平年代,還繼續這樣想的話,不是我說不好。而是說你浪費了生命只有一次的可貴。你錯過了太多美好的事物:樂曲,繪畫,雕塑,高效率,山川等等。
為什麼vim只能面向程式設計師,這種可以節約我們生命時間的東西為何不能迅速普及?為何這種簡單方便的學習教程不能迅速展開,模仿?
時間是公平的,也許你用了一輩子來思考為何光速在哪個地方都是一樣的?(某個物理假設)
你來過一次,只做了一件事,這個世界再也不會有你,永永遠遠離開了這個世界,乃至整個宇宙,整個時間,你永遠不會再出現。
這是一件最可悲的事情,就是我們明明生在巨人身後,卻不能站在巨人的肩膀上?真的是有點浪費
最後宣告:文章之寫給需要的人,有很多人註定不需要人生不留遺憾,不用更加美好。請對號入座,認識自己,決定自己的路同樣重要,沒有高低貴賤之分。
人生是沒有任何意義的,只是你安逸了一生,浪費了造物主的心血,矇蔽了自己的雙眼。
我們在追求效率的同時,就擁有了新的事業和精力,就可以理解並且可以練習,可以真的理解梵高的畫,而不是走到面前比劃一個二字,真的是。。。。
在你努力的時候,找到了方法,你走了很多彎路,也許才知道了數學,化學,物理對於這個世界的意義揭露的美妙世界。你才可以理解量子物理和經典物理,你才會欣賞到美麗的星雲到底為何物?也許當你有了精力之後,真的願意去學習鋼琴,也許你真的開始明白樂譜不只是你之前的手機鈴聲,而是匆匆你嘴裡哼唱出來的一種旋律,才會體會到巴赫,莫扎特留下的遺產,也許你會喜歡物業江城古典音樂的音樂主播
人生超程式設計。發現一點美妙,也許下一刻滅亡也無所謂,否則就會一直美妙下去。立地方能成佛。
掙錢不是嘴說的,但你腦袋只想著家裡一畝三分地,可能掙到錢嗎?政府,經濟,財團,國際貨幣組織的來歷,國家這種抽象的概念真的是封閉沒有聯絡的嗎?你手裡的錢真的就是一輩子都這樣的,和別人沒有半毛錢關係?近期,收購到南昌萬達的包工頭對我們只是說人家命運好?都是寒門子弟,不是命好不好,而是向死而生的美妙。
教育子女,我真的覺得很多人沒有歷史責任感,真的是廢物。人類文明是傳承,不是你的一家之言。
但行好事,莫問前程
願法界眾生,皆得安樂。
本文轉自 jackdongting 51CTO部落格,原文連結:http://blog.51cto.com/10725691/1951867
相關文章
- Vim 環境下 Markdown 外掛推薦
- vim 環境寫 markdown 的外掛推薦
- 編輯推薦之《推薦系統》
- Echarts-PHP 包推薦EchartsPHP
- 好書推薦--Modern PHPPHP
- PHP新手推薦書籍PHP
- 推薦系統論文之序列推薦:KERL
- php包管理工具推薦PHP
- PHP:40+開發工具推薦PHP
- php 高效率寫法 推薦PHP
- 【推薦系統篇】--推薦系統之訓練模型模型
- 推薦給開發者的11個PHP框架PHP框架
- 【推薦系統篇】--推薦系統之測試資料
- 《推薦系統學習》之推薦系統那點事
- 應用推薦之 Ai SearchAI
- 浪潮之巔作者吳軍推薦序——《推薦系統實踐》
- PHP 5.3以上版本推薦使用mysqlnd驅動PHPMySql
- php多使用者商城系統推薦PHP
- 非常實用的PHP程式碼片段推薦PHP
- 推薦一個 PHP 管道外掛 LeaguePipelinePHP
- 推薦給開發者的20個優秀PHP框架PHP框架
- 推薦2013年最佳PHP開發框架PHP框架
- 【推薦系統篇】--推薦系統之之特徵工程部分---構建訓練集流程特徵工程
- 推薦系統入門之使用協同過濾實現商品推薦
- WPF優秀元件推薦之FreeSpire元件
- WPF優秀元件推薦之Stylet(一)元件
- Google:未來之鏡–推薦圖書Go
- 微破譯-php原始碼混淆解密破解工具推薦PHP原始碼解密
- 推薦一個php7+ mongodb三方類PHPMongoDB
- 推薦一個 PHP 網路請求外掛 GuzzlePHP
- 推薦一個 PHP 管道外掛 League\PipelinePHP
- 誰能推薦推薦好的 PHP 設計模式得書籍和有關框架核心得書籍PHP設計模式框架
- ML.NET 示例:推薦之矩陣分解矩陣
- 推薦系統之冷啟動問題
- 推薦系統之資訊繭房問題
- 推薦系統之業務架構總覽架構
- WPF優秀元件推薦之MahApps元件APP
- 圖書推薦之希望圖靈引進圖靈